Easy Homemade Candy Apples

These Easy Homemade Candy Apples are the perfect sweet fall-inspired treat that only requires 5 ingredients and about 5 minutes to make from scratch!
Course Dessert
Cuisine Halloween
Prep Time 5 minutes
Cook Time 0 minutes
cooling time 30 minutes
Total Time 35 minutes
Servings 10
Calories 374kcal

Ingredients

  • 10 medium apples
  • 3 cups sugar
  • ½ cup light corn syrup
  • 1 cup water
  • ½ teaspoon red food coloring

Instructions

  • Wash and dry apples; if your apples have a wax coating, dip them in boiling water to remove the wax.
  • Insert lollipop sticks into tops of apples, being sure to make it about halfway down.
  • Line baking sheet with parchment paper and set aside.
  • Combine sugar, water and corn syrup into heavy bottom pot.
  • On medium heat, bring mixture to a boil.
  • Using a candy thermometer, keeping the heat on medium, cook the mixture until it reaches 300 degrees Fahrenheit (the hard crack stage).
  • Remove the mixture from heat and stir in red food coloring.
  • Carefully dip each apple into the mixture, swirling to cover the entire apple.
  • Allow the excess candy mixture to drip back into the pan before moving the apples to the parchment lined baking sheet.
  • Allow the apples to cool completely before serving.
